1508955
0x7dfe5a3cf642e0c811934ee543d05c1a19cc491497356e446f98afcb5d78d31b
Transactions0
Height1508955
Confirmations8930581
Timestamp744 days 11 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x447ea9a1e5586254
Bits
Difficulty0x6ffe75f